Imaging Center Manager salary in Argentina

Average Yearly Salary of Imaging Center Manager in Argentina is approximately 5,212,727 ARS (17,332 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Imaging Center Manager do?

occupation personasAn Imaging Center Manager is responsible for overseeing the operations and administration of an imaging center, ensuring the delivery of high-quality diagnostic imaging services. They manage the daily activities, including scheduling patient appointments, coordinating staff schedules, and maintaining equipment and supplies. The manager also ensures compliance with regulatory standards and protocols, manages budgets and financial performance, and collaborates with healthcare providers to ensure efficient workflow and patient satisfaction. Additionally, they may be involved in staff recruitment, training, and performance evaluation.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ary.
